The concept refers to a focused approach to spiritual or personal development, choosing to bypass superficial distractions and trivial pursuits to concentrate on deeper, more meaningful practices. As an example, individuals might choose meditation and self-reflection over engaging in social activities deemed unproductive to their overall well-being.
The importance of this lies in its ability to foster a sense of purpose, enhance self-awareness, and cultivate inner peace. Historically, various spiritual traditions have emphasized the need to detach from worldly attachments and frivolous activities to attain enlightenment or a higher state of consciousness. This directness allows for greater efficiency in achieving personal goals and a more profound connection with one’s inner self.
